#78c0ce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#78c0ce is composed of 47.1% red, 75.3%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.7% cyan, 6.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 189.8 degrees, a saturation of 46.7% and a lightness of 63.9%. #78c0ce color hex could be obtained by blending #f0ffff with #00819d.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

#78c0ce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#78c0ce has RGB values of R:120, G:192,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0.42, M:0.07,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 7913678.

Hex triplet 78c0ce #78c0ce
RGB Decimal 120, 192, 206 rgb(120,192,206)
RGB Percent 47.1, 75.3, 80.8 rgb(47.1%,75.3%,80.8%)
CMYK 42, 7, 0, 19
HSL 189.8°, 46.7, 63.9 hsl(189.8,46.7%,63.9%)
HSV (or HSB) 189.8°, 41.7, 80.8
Web Safe 66cccc #66cccc
CIE-LAB 73.641, -18.904, -14.115
XYZ 37.733, 46.147, 65.308
xyY 0.253, 0.309, 46.147
CIE-LCH 73.641, 23.592, 216.748
CIE-LUV 73.641, -33.335, -18.915
Hunter-Lab 67.931, -19.73, -9.449
Binary 01111000, 11000000, 11001110

Shades and Tints of #78c0ce

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030809 is the darkest color, while #fafc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#78c0ce

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a2a3a4 is the less saturated color, while #4eddf8 is the most saturated one.
